Theft or Fraud by Computer in Miami, Florida

There are a number of criminal offenses related to computers and the internet. Theft crimes which may be related to computer or cybercrime may include: identity theft, fraud, grand theft, unauthorized access, hacking, spamming, spoofing, phishing, and more. Most Florida computer crimes are charged as felonies, punishable by at least 1 year in state prison and heavy fines.

Fraud and Computer Crimes in Florida

The majority of theft crimes associated with computers and the internet are related to fraud, theft by way of deception. When a computer and the internet are used to commit fraud, wire fraud charges are most likely to be pursued by the prosecution.

Wire fraud is an extremely serious federal crime that involves using the internet to transmit information that is intended to defraud others in order to obtain their money or property. Because this crime most often involves crossed state lines or national borders, the federal government may investigate and prosecute these offenses. If convicted of wire fraud in federal court, a defendant may face up to 20 years in prison and heavy fines. If a financial institution is targeted or affected by this computer crime, the defendant may face up to 30 years in prison and/or a fine of up to $1 million.
